The way Mobile Data Is Consumed at Instaspin Casino
Instaspin Casino works entirely through a mobile-optimized web interface. Each spin, animation, and sound file loads progressively from remote servers rather than from local storage. This architecture holds the initial page weight low but generates continuous background requests that gather over time. A typical session fetches game assets, communicates bet outcomes, reloads lobby thumbnails, and occasionally loads again promotional banners. None of these operations is big individually, but their aggregate effect on a limited data plan can be surprising after a few evenings of casual play.
Resource Loading Patterns In the Course of Gameplay
When a player opens a slot title at Instaspin Casino, the browser fetches a compressed package of symbols, background images, and sound sprites. The size of this initial payload differs by provider. Pragmatic Play titles often download a 12–18 MB bundle, while smaller studios may deliver 6–10 MB. After the first spin, only incremental data goes between the device and the game server. However, changing between three or four titles in a single session amplifies the data footprint because each game initiates its own fresh asset download.
Real Dealer Tables and Streaming Overhead
Real-time casino sections present an completely different data profile. A live blackjack or roulette stream at Instaspin Casino uses adaptive bitrate technology that changes video quality based on connection speed. On a steady 4G network, the stream usually settles at 720p resolution, requiring roughly 1.2 GB per hour. On 5G, the encoder may push 1080p, which goes closer to 1.8 GB hourly. Audio alone contributes 60–80 MB per hour. For limited plan users, a 30-minute live dealer session can erase 600–900 MB, making it the most expensive activity on the platform from a data perspective.
Background Data Leakage Between Spins
Not all data usage at Instaspin Casino is visible or intentional. The platform periodically pings analytics endpoints, refreshes session tokens, and scans for updated promotions even when the screen looks idle. These background calls are minor, usually 50–200 KB each, but they occur every 30–90 seconds. Over a two-hour session, background chatter alone can build up 40–80 MB. Players who leave a browser tab open while doing other things may unintentionally consume a significant slice of their monthly allowance without placing a single bet.

Calculating Real-World Data Consumption on a 5 GB Plan
A controlled test using a Canadian carrier with a strict 5 GB cap monitored Instaspin Casino across three various session types. The measurement tool captured all HTTP requests, WebSocket streams, and media transfers at the device level. Results revealed that data usage is not uniform—it spikes during game loading, flattens during repetitive spins, and surges again when switching titles. Understanding these patterns helps a limited plan user to distribute their remaining gigabytes with exactness rather than guessing when the dreaded throttle warning will arrive.
Slots-Exclusive Session: 90 Minutes of Continuous Play
Playing five favorite slot titles in rotation for 90 minutes ate up 412 MB total. The breakdown revealed that 38% of that traffic stemmed from initial game loads, 52% from spin result transmissions and animation updates, and 10% from background processes. The test used manual spin mode with no autoplay. Average per-spin data was 0.08 MB, implying a player could complete roughly 5,000 spins before depleting 400 MB. That figure gives a useful budgeting benchmark for anyone who views their data cap like a bankroll.
Mixed Session: Slots, Lobby Browsing, and One Live Table Visit
A more authentic session blending 60 minutes of slots, 15 minutes of lobby navigation, and 20 minutes of live roulette used 1,340 MB. The live dealer segment alone represented 610 MB. Lobby browsing, which involves loading thumbnail grids and promotional carousels, amounted to 95 MB. The slot portion made up 635 MB due to frequent title switching. This mixed profile matches how many Canadian players actually act—dipping into different sections during a single evening—and it illustrates how quickly a 5 GB plan can vanish when live streaming enters the mix.

Wi-Fi Pre-Loading as a Pre-Session Habit
One neglected tactic includes loading a game at Instaspin Casino while still linked to home or public Wi-Fi, then changing to mobile data only after the initial assets have fully downloaded. The browser cache holds the heavy graphical elements, and the subsequent mobile data session transmits only lightweight spin results. This approach can reduce a slot session’s data footprint by 70% or more. It requires no special software—only the dedication to open the game before leaving a Wi-Fi zone. For players who commute or move frequently, this habit becomes a dependable data-saving habit.

Provider Throttling and Its Influence on Gameplay
Canadian carriers like Rogers, Bell, and Telus implement throttling once a subscriber surpasses their plan cap. Throttled speeds typically decrease to 512 Kbps or lower, which is enough for text and email but harsh for real-time gaming. At 512 Kbps, Instaspin Casino slot games stay technically playable but endure from extended load times and occasional spin delays. Live dealer streams become unwatchable, defaulting to the lowest bitrate tier or failing entirely. The platform does not manage this outcome; it simply delivers what the connection can accept, and on a throttled pipe, that is often not enough for a smooth experience.
Identifying the Signs of a Throttled Connection
A player on a throttled connection will detect game thumbnails loading slowly, spin animations stuttering, and live dealer feeds buffering every 15–20 seconds. These symptoms are not platform bugs—they are bandwidth starvation indicators. Instaspin Casino’s servers continue to respond normally, but the data packets get to the device in a trickle rather than a stream. The most practical response is to close live dealer sections immediately and move to low-bandwidth slot titles with simpler animations. Some older game releases use static backgrounds and minimal particle effects, making them far more lenient on degraded connections.

Browser Cache Performance and Its Limits
Modern mobile browsers save game assets in cache after the first load. If a player goes back to the same slot title within the same day, the browser loads most images and sounds from local storage rather than fetching anew them. This can cut reload data by 60–80%. However, cache storage is limited, and mobile operating systems frequently delete browser caches when storage pressure rises. A player who switches between many titles or plays rarely may find that the cache benefit is unreliable. Depending on cache alone is not a trustworthy data strategy.
Manual Spin vs. Autoplay Data Implications
Autoplay mode at Instaspin Casino uses the same amount of data per spin as manual play, but it boosts the spin frequency substantially. A player clicking manually might do 150 spins per hour. Autoplay set to fast turbo mode can reach 600–800 spins in the same period. The per-spin data cost remains unchanged, but the total hourly consumption grows by four or five. For a user on a limited plan, disabling autoplay is one of the easiest and most efficient data-saving actions accessible, requiring no technical configuration and producing immediate measurable results.

Is it possible for a VPN reduce data consumption at Instaspin Casino?
A VPN does not reduce data consumption; it typically raises it by 5–15% due to encryption overhead and additional packet headers. While a VPN can help with privacy and geo-location concerns, it introduces extra bytes to every transmission. Limited plan users should be cognizant that routing Instaspin Casino traffic through a VPN will slightly hasten data depletion rather than reduce it.
